English: <p>Students must meet English language proficiency requirements through standardized tests such as IELTS or TOEFL. Generally, an IELTS score of 6.5 with no band lower than 6.0 or a TOEFL score of 86 with a minimum of 20 in each section is expected. However, exact requirements can vary, so it is advisable to check with the university for specific criteria.</p>
International students: <p>International students must ensure they meet visa requirements to study in Canada. It is essential to have a valid study permit and provide documents such as proof of acceptance from the university, proof of sufficient funds for tuition and living expenses, and a recent medical examination in some cases. It is recommended to check the official government website for detailed and updated visa requirements.</p>
